Responsibilities:

  • Provide individual and group art therapy services to a diverse client population, including adolescents, adults, and older adults.
  • Work with varied diagnosis such as autism/special needs, mental health, SUD/AODA, neurodegenerative diseases, end of life care, and more.
  • Develop and implement treatment plans tailored to each client's needs.
  • Collaborate with other professionals to ensure holistic care.
  •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ation.
  • Travel to various locations to provide services.

Qualifications:

  • Master's Degree in Art Therapy.
  • ATR, ATRL, AT-BC, LPC-IT, LPC, and/or SAC-IT (or actively working towards licensure).
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and clinical skills.
  • Strong artistic abilities and a passion for using art as a therapeutic tool.
  • Valid driver's license, reliable vehicle, and auto insurance.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• 2+ years of professional experience as an Art Therapist.
